Output 95cd036c62bc24bf6501fc1034a8074fc3572d56e6368075d4a93a55ce243f34:0

value
98875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8e86adb25df820bc6eb5ef90fce9e642a288dc OP_EQUAL
address
3HWhZciYGijZLdrKZ4yaVh6UnpN81vziKQ
transaction
95cd036c62bc24bf6501fc1034a8074fc3572d56e6368075d4a93a55ce243f34
spent
true